Three LeT militants killed in Kashmir gunbattle (Lead changing dateline)
June 3rd, 2011 - 3:00 pm ICT by IANSSrinagar, June 3 (IANS) Three separatist guerrillas, including a top commander of the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T), were killed in an overnight gunfight in Jammu and Kashmir’s Sopore town, police said Friday.
According to police, Rashtriya Rifles (RR) troops and police jointly surrounded Seer area of Sopore Thursday afternoon after getting information about the presence of a group of heavily armed separatist guerrillas.
“As the security forces were laying a cordon around the area, the militants opened fire, triggering a gunfight which ended this (Friday) morning,” a police officer said.
According to him, two guerrillas were gunned down Thursday evening while the third was killed early Friday. “The militants were holed up inside an under-construction house in the area.”
A top LeT commander, Abdullah Babar, who is also a foreigner, was also killed in the gunfight, police said.
Police recovered three AK-47 rifles and seven magazines from the slain guerrillas.
Security forces had gunned down two LeT guerrillas in Sopore town last week as well.
